Sony DSC-T90/T900
February 28 | Posted by Andri Kurniawan | Digital Camera, New GadgetsHow about ultra thin instead of ultra zoom? Both of these new T-series cameras sport touchscreen LCDs and HD movie modes, with the flagship T900 offering an HDMI port via a bundled camera cradle. Here’s more: Cyber-shot DSC-T90 12.1 Megapixel CCD F3.5-4.6, 4X optical zoom lens, equivalent to 35 – 140 mm Optical image stabilization Ultra-compact body is just 15 mm thin; comes... Read more
